Vibrant Moroccan Rugs: A Legacy of Craftsmanship

Moroccan rugs have fascinated the world with their rich colors and intricate designs. Each rug is a testament to the talented hands that craft them, passing down ancient techniques from generation to generation. The versatile nature of these rugs allows them to complement any interior, adding a touch of authenticity.

From the geometric patterns of the Beni Ourain to the vibrant hues of the Boujaad, each region in Morocco boasts its own characteristic style. These rugs are not merely floor coverings; they are expressions of heritage that tell a story of Moroccan history and heritage.
